Double Unbrella Strollers..
is there such a thing? I am talking about the very basic ones. No need for cup holders or baskets underneath. JUST the double stroller.
We sold ALL of our strollers, and it dawned on me now.. since we're about to make a HUGE move, that I may need a very simple double stroller. Anyone know of one? TIA.

I used the Jeep stroller (I think we paid $70??) for quick trips with my girls and I absolutely LOVED it. It was so easy to get in and out of the car. It's not the best stroller but it does the job. For some extra 'storage' I bought one of those nets (paid $1) and hung it on the back of one of the strollers. I could put jackets, toys, cups, etc. On the other side I usually put my purse or their bag. Highly recommend it vs putting two strollers together because I've seen others do that and the clips come apart.
